How to Play Snow by Zach Bryan on Guitar<\/h2>\n\n\n\n

The Chords and Strumming Pattern<\/h3>\n\n\n\n

The chords for “Snow” are straightforward. The song is played in the key of G major, so the chords are G, Cadd9, D, and Em7. To play the strumming pattern correctly, you should start with downstrokes on beats 1 and 3 and upstrokes on beats 2 and 4. <\/p>\n\n\n\n

This creates a steady rhythm that will keep your playing consistent. Additionally, make sure you don’t hit the open strings when switching between chords; this will give your playing clarity and help keep it sounding smooth.<\/p>\n\n\n\n

Finger Picking Pattern<\/h3>\n\n\n\n

This is where things get interesting! To create the unique sound of “Snow,” you must incorporate fingerpicking into your playing. <\/p>\n\n\n\n

Use your thumb to pick through all four strings while using your index finger to pluck out notes on the high E string (the thinnest one). <\/p>\n\n\n\n

You can use this same pattern for each chord progression throughout the song; ensure you keep that same rhythm going!<\/p>\n\n\n\n
